The correct order for ON/OFF switching of the various products is as follows:
On: always first the source, then the pre-amplifier, followed by the power amplifier.
Off: always first the power amplifier, then the pre-amplifier, followed by the source.
With the Q-Link connection switch ON the DAC first (to produce the MCK) and second the
transport.
To prevent damage to your loudspeakers it is advisable, both at switching ON and OFF to turn the
volume control fully to the left. Fully anti-clockwise sets the volume at its lowest level. The same
applies when changing sources.

12. Output digital OPTICAL. SPDif optical output TosLink.
13. Output digital RCA. SPDif output RCA.
14. Output digital XLR. AES / EBU balanced output.
15. Output digital Q-Link. Output to connect the CT360 via Q-Link for I2S connection to e.g. the
vM DA converters. There are four RCA connectors: for the DATA, MCK, LRCK en BCK. The
MCK is the master clock input, the other three are outputs. Connect these to the same
named connectors on the converter.
For best audio results, it is important to use four identical cables of good quality.
Take care to use the right signal direction of the cables!
Separate the MCK cable from the other three cables to reduce influence.
This Q-Link output will be operational when the MCK from the DAC is received.

Signal format
16 bit PCM - 44.1 kHz
Disc format
CD, CD-R, CD-RW
Frequency response CD
2-20,000 Hz
Signal to noise ratio / distortion
> 120 dB / < 0.002 %
Channel separation
> 100 dB
Outputs / connectors analog
2 / RCA + XLR
Analog output RCA / XLR
2.0Vrms / 4.0Vrms
Outputs / connectors digital
4 / Q-Link, XLR, RCA + Optical
Digital output
0.5 Vp-p, EBU-XLR 4Vp-p
Power supply
115-230 Volt / 50-60 Hz
Power consumption
10 / 20 Watt, stby / on
Weight
11 kg
Size w x h (h+feet) x d
434 x 88 (102) x 390 mm

The digital outputs are clocked for the different digital inputs.
By switching over between inputs, there can be a synchronicity moment occur where by the
transport stays in the mute mode. In that situation, the CT360 can be reset by switching off with the
power switch for approximately 10 seconds and then again to on.
The SPDif XLR, RCA and optical outputs are able to transmit digital stereo signals to converters
capable to receive 16bit/44.1kHz. This is the standard CD format.
The Q-Link outputs send the DATA, LRCK and BCK from the CD transport to the DAC. The MCK
master clock input must receive a frequency of 16.9344MHz from the DAC.
When this MCK is received, in the front display the indication LED (5) goes on.
All audio CD’s, CD-R’s and CD-RW’s can be played without a problem only when they are
produced following the Red Book protocol.
